Symptoms

  • •Steering wheel vibration at speeds above 50 mph
  • •Uneven tire wear patterns
  • •Pulling to one side during driving
  • •Noises from the front end while driving
  • •Shakiness in the steering wheel when braking

Solution
1. Tire Inspection
  • Sub-steps:
    1. Remove the tire and inspect for any bulges, cracks, or punctures.
    2. Measure tire tread depth using a tread depth gauge; replace tires if tread is below recommended levels.
    3. Check tire pressure and inflate to the manufacturer’s specifications (usually found on the driver’s door jamb).
2. Wheel Balancing
  • Sub-steps:
    1. Remove the wheel from the vehicle.
    2. Mount the wheel on a wheel balancer.
    3. Adjust the wheel weights as necessary to achieve balance; ensure weights are secured properly.
    4. Reinstall the wheel onto the vehicle, ensuring lug nuts are torqued to manufacturer specifications (usually around 80-100 ft-lbs).
3. Wheel Alignment
  • Sub-steps:
    1. Position the vehicle on a level alignment rack.
    2. Use alignment equipment to measure the camber, caster, and toe angles.
    3. Adjust the alignment settings to meet the manufacturer’s specifications.
    4. Test drive the vehicle to confirm the alignment is correct.
4. Suspension Inspection
  • Sub-steps:
    1. Raise the vehicle and secure it on jack stands.
    2. Inspect the tie rods for any play or damage; replace if necessary.
    3. Check ball joints for movement; replace if they are worn or loose.
    4. Inspect bushings for signs of cracking or excessive wear; replace as needed.
